**Q: Where can I review the stale-cache incident analysis?**
A: The Fernbright team's postmortem covers the root cause (a missed invalidation path in the Copperline cache layer), affected data classes, and remediation timeline. No credential material was exposed. The complete report, including the security annex, is available at the internal page below.

dashboard of fajop-kajeg = https://artifactory.paliqnet.example/settings

# Snapshot testing env — Corvette UI kit (Brindlework release pipeline)
# Release manager: run snapshot suite before tagging. Baselines live in
# the Fernlock bucket; diffs over 0.1% fail the build. Do not regenerate
# baselines on Fridays. SNAPSHOT_MODE=strict is required for release
# branches. Uploading diff artifacts requires write access to the
# Fernlock bucket, so the token goes on the line below:

sealed setting: ARCHIVE_KEY3=8d0

Broker upgrade: Fennelmq 4.2 → 5.0 on the ledger cluster. Drain consumers, snapshot queues, upgrade one node per hour. Mixed-version mode is supported for 24h max. Rollback: restore snapshot, repin clients to 4.2. Metrics dashboard is under infra/fennelmq-upgrade. The upgrade orchestrator authenticates against the internal Relayhub service with the key below.

service key, fawip-bajef: kto11_Qt5wZK9vdNC

Ticket: TEXTSCAN-442 — signature check failing on encoder module

The charset-detection module for the UploadSift pipeline fails signature verification on deploy. Cause: the build was signed with the retired Q2 release identity after rotation. Impact: encoding detection for uploaded text files falls back to ASCII-only, mangling non-Latin uploads. Fix: rebuild from the release tag and re-sign with the current identity before pushing. Current signing key is below — verify it matches the registry record.

signing key of bagap-yawep = bky13_TbfT6ZMUoGJo2

Handover Note — Headcount Plan FY Next

For the finance team, from the outgoing director to Priya Mandel. The draft headcount plan assumes 14 net additions: eight in engineering at the Calderbrook site, four in customer success, two in finance operations. Backfills for the Westrow departures are already budgeted. Contractor spend should taper from Q2. One confidential point on organisational plans is recorded directly below this note.

board note of fafog-yahap: Project Rusdor slips by a full year because of the audit delay.